3. What are Examples of Unethical Animal Tourism Practices?
Unethical animal tourism practices encompass a range of activities that cause harm or distress to animals for the sake of entertainment or profit. Examples of these practices include:
- Elephant riding: Elephants are often subjected to cruel training methods and forced to carry tourists for long hours, causing physical and psychological harm.
- Tiger selfies: Tigers are often drugged or restrained to allow tourists to take photos with them, which is both dangerous and unethical.
- Captive dolphin shows: Dolphins are kept in small tanks and forced to perform tricks, which can lead to stress, injury, and premature death.
- Wildlife markets: The sale of endangered species and their body parts in wildlife markets contributes to poaching and habitat destruction.
- Animal performances: Animals are forced to perform tricks in circuses and other entertainment venues, often subjected to cruel training methods and deprived of their natural behaviors.

8. What Laws and Regulations Protect Animals in the Vietnamese Tourism Industry?
Vietnam has several laws and regulations in place to protect animals in the tourism industry. The key regulations include:
- Law on Biodiversity: This law provides a legal framework for the conservation of biodiversity, including the protection of endangered species and their habitats.
- Law on Forest Protection and Development: This law regulates the management and protection of forests, which are vital habitats for many animal species.
- Law on Fisheries: This law regulates the management and exploitation of aquatic resources, including the protection of marine animals.
- Decree No. 32/2006/ND-CP on the Management of Endangered, Precious, and Rare Species of Wild Plants and Animals: This decree provides specific regulations for the protection of endangered species, including restrictions on hunting, trade, and exploitation.
- Circular No. 25/2017/TT-BNNPTNT guiding the implementation of the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species of Wild Fauna and Flora (CITES): This circular implements CITES regulations in Vietnam, controlling the import and export of endangered species.
Enforcement of these laws and regulations remains a challenge, but the Vietnamese government is working to strengthen its efforts to protect animals in the tourism industry. SIXT.VN supports these efforts and encourages travelers to report any violations of animal welfare laws to the authorities.

12. What Certifications Should I Look for in Sustainable Tourism Operators?
When choosing sustainable tourism operators, look for certifications from reputable organizations such as:
- Travelife: This certification recognizes tourism businesses that are committed to sustainability and environmental management.
- Green Globe: This certification recognizes tourism businesses that meet international standards for sustainable tourism.
- B Corp: This certification recognizes businesses that meet high standards of social and environmental performance, accountability, and transparency.
- Fair Trade Tourism: This certification recognizes tourism businesses that are committed to fair labor practices and community development.
- Ecotourism Australia: This certification recognizes tourism businesses that meet national standards for ecotourism.
These certifications provide assurance that the tourism operator is committed to sustainability and responsible business practices. SIXT.VN partners with certified operators to ensure that our customers have access to the most ethical and sustainable tourism options available.

17. What are the Challenges in Promoting Responsible Animal Tourism in Vietnam?
Promoting responsible animal tourism in Vietnam faces several challenges, including:
- Lack of Awareness: Many tourists are unaware of the ethical issues surrounding animal tourism.
- Demand for Unethical Activities: There is still a strong demand for unethical activities, such as elephant riding and captive dolphin shows.
- Weak Enforcement of Laws: Enforcement of animal welfare laws is often weak, allowing unethical operators to continue operating with impunity.
- Poverty: Poverty can drive local communities to engage in unsustainable tourism practices, such as poaching and wildlife trade.
- Corruption: Corruption can hinder efforts to regulate the tourism industry and protect animals.
Overcoming these challenges requires a multi-faceted approach that includes education, advocacy, law enforcement, and community development. SIXT.VN is committed to working with our partners and stakeholders to address these challenges and promote responsible animal tourism in Vietnam.

3. Are Elephant Sanctuaries in Vietnam Ethical?
Not all elephant sanctuaries are ethical. True sanctuaries prioritize the well-being of elephants, allowing them to roam freely, providing proper care, and not forcing them to perform for tourists. Avoid sanctuaries that offer elephant riding or other activities that exploit elephants.
